Shan Hai Jing Journey: The Path to the Beyond
In the heart of the ancient Chinese empire, where the mountains reach the sky and the seas whisper ancient secrets, there lay a text known as the Shan Hai Jing. This ancient tome, said to be the record of the world's wonders and mysteries, was a guidebook for those brave enough to seek the unknown. Among the many who had ventured into its pages, none had dared to pursue the Path to the Beyond, a journey that was whispered to be the crossing into a realm beyond the veil of reality.
The MC, a young and ambitious scholar named Li, had spent years decoding the cryptic verses of the Shan Hai Jing. His quest was not merely scholarly; it was a quest for enlightenment and the truth about the world beyond the known. Li had heard tales of the Path to the Beyond, a mystical route that could only be accessed by those who had proven their worth through trials and tribulations.
One moonlit night, as the silver glow of the moon reflected off the tranquil waters of the Yangtze River, Li stood before the ancient temple of Mount Kunlun, the starting point of the Path to the Beyond. The temple, an ancient structure covered in moss and ivy, stood as a silent sentinel to the secrets of the past.
Li's journey began with a challenge: to find the legendary Dragon Bone Flute, a magical instrument said to be the key to unlocking the Path. With the help of his loyal companions, a wise old sage named Wu and a fierce warrior named Hua, Li set out into the wilds of the mountains and forests.
As they journeyed, they encountered the many creatures of the Shan Hai Jing, from the nine-tailed foxes of Mount Tai to the fire-breathing dragons of the Eastern Sea. Each encounter tested their courage, wisdom, and friendship. Li's knowledge of the ancient text proved invaluable, as he deciphered the riddles and avoided the traps set by the spirits of the mountains and seas.
One fateful night, as they camped by a serene lake, Wu shared a tale of the first adventurer who had succeeded in reaching the Path to the Beyond. This adventurer, known as the Great Sage, had faced the ultimate test: the Heart of the Dragon, a chamber deep within the mountains that held the essence of the dragon spirit itself.
Li, Wu, and Hua knew that their own test would be no less daunting. The Heart of the Dragon was a place where the mind and spirit were tested to the utmost. Only those pure of heart and steadfast in purpose could pass through its trials.
The trio reached the chamber, a cavern of darkness and silence. In the center stood a colossal statue of a dragon, its eyes glowing with an otherworldly light. Li took a deep breath and approached the statue, his heart pounding with anticipation.
The Heart of the Dragon spoke, its voice a deep rumble that echoed through the cavern. "You seek the Path to the Beyond, but you must first face the truth within your own heart." The dragon's eyes bore into Li, and he felt a surge of self-doubt and fear.
Wu stepped forward, his ancient wisdom guiding him. "The Path to the Beyond is not just a physical journey; it is a journey of the soul. Only by confronting the darkest parts of oneself can one truly find the path to enlightenment."
Li took a step back, his resolve strengthening. He faced the dragon once more, his heart now filled with determination. "I seek not just the Path to the Beyond, but the truth of my own existence. I will confront the darkness within and emerge a wiser, stronger person."
The dragon's eyes softened, and it nodded. "You have passed the first test. Now, you must face the final challenge: the test of the five elements."
The ground beneath Li's feet began to tremble, and the five elements of earth, water, fire, wind, and metal converged upon him. He was enveloped in a tempest of sand, a flood of water, a scorching inferno, a whirlwind of gale-force winds, and a solid wall of metal. Each element tested his resolve, his strength, and his will to survive.
Through each trial, Li's companions stood by his side, their support and encouragement fueling his spirit. They faced their own challenges, each element testing their strengths and weaknesses.
Finally, the trials ended, and Li stood before the dragon, unscathed. "You have proven yourself worthy," the dragon declared. "The Path to the Beyond is now open to you."
Li, Wu, and Hua stepped through the portal, the Path to the Beyond stretching out before them. They had faced the trials of the Heart of the Dragon and emerged victorious, their souls cleansed and their minds sharpened.
As they ventured deeper into the realm beyond, they discovered a world of wonder and peril, a place where the boundaries between myth and reality blurred. The Path to the Beyond was not just a journey to a new world; it was a journey to the depths of their own souls.
In the end, Li realized that the true power of the Shan Hai Jing lay not in the text itself, but in the journey it inspired. The Path to the Beyond was a metaphor for the endless quest for knowledge, self-discovery, and the courage to face the unknown.
And so, the MC's Shan Hai Jing Journey continued, a testament to the enduring power of myth and the indomitable spirit of adventure.
